  1. Gigantothermy
    (pronounced jie-GANT-oh-therm-ee) Gigantothermy is the maintenance of a constant, relatively high body temperature by having a large body and insulation. Large animals have a relatively low surface area: volume ratio, so they retain heat better than smaller animals.

  3. Gigantothermy
    Gigantothermy (sometimes called ectothermic homeothermy) is a phenomenon with significance in biology and paleontology, whereby large, bulky ectothermic animals are more easily able to maintain a constant, relatively high body temperature than smaller animals by virtue of their smaller surface area...
